  • Patent number: 7788744
    Abstract: Sleeping compartment support assemblies and methods of driving the same are disclosed to selectively provide reciprocating motion to a sleeping enclosure. An example sleeping compartment support has a drive mechanism that utilizes a rotary motor and a slider crank assembly to generate substantially planar motion in a generally horizontal plane.

  • Patent number: 6843498
    Abstract: A stroller assembly may include a frame with first and second spaced members. First and second seats may be attached to the frame. The second seat may have a seat base and a seat back, the first and second spaced members disposed opposite each other across seat base. The stroller assembly may also include at least one member disposed opposite the seat back in at least first and second positions. The seat base, seat back, spaced members and the at least one member may define at least two recesses, the first recess defined with the at least one member in the first position to accept a first infant transporter and the second recess defined with at least one member in the second position to accept a second infant transporter different than the first infant transporter.

  • Patent number: 6785922
    Abstract: A mattress has an internal support structure and an external cladding that surrounds and covers at least a portion of the support structure. The mattress also has a vibrating device that is coupled to a part of the support structure. The vibrating device has a motor that operates to transmit vibrations throughout the support structure when turned on. The mattress can be adapted to gradually slow at a controlled rate to a complete stop over a period of time when turned off. The mattress can also be adapted to include the vibrating device internally where the device is water resistant. The mattress can also be adapted such that the vibrating device can be easily removed and installed from a pocket provided in the mattress.
